Ormat Technologies, Inc. - Ormat Technologies Accelerates Enhanced Geothermal System (EGS) Deployments and Introduces Ormega100 Unit to Commercialize and Scale the Largest Binary Unit in the Industry


Ormat Technologies, Inc., a leading company in renewable energy solutions, has announced significant advancements in its Enhanced Geothermal System (EGS) initiatives. This strategic move is set to revolutionize the geothermal energy landscape by allowing for more efficient harnessing of geothermal resources. The introduction of the Ormega100 unit marks a pivotal moment, as it is touted to be the largest binary unit in the industry, promising to enhance energy production capabilities and sustainability.



Accelerating EGS Deployments


With the increasing global demand for clean energy solutions, Ormat Technologies is poised to respond effectively through its advanced EGS technology. The company has made substantial investments in research and development, focusing on the optimization and scaling of geothermal energy production. By accelerating EGS deployments, Ormat aims to unlock geothermal resources that were previously considered non-viable, thereby expanding the potential of geothermal energy.



Introducing the Ormega100 Unit


The Ormega100 unit represents a significant technological breakthrough in the geothermal sector. This innovative binary cycle unit is designed to maximize energy extraction from geothermal sources while minimizing environmental impact. The Ormega100's unparalleled efficiency is expected to set new benchmarks in the industry, enabling power plants to produce more energy from lower temperature geothermal resources. This is particularly crucial as the world continues to seek sustainable energy options that do not compromise the environment.
